Staff Spotlight Shines on Reagan Smith
When he does get a chance to go home, it’s to his wife of 32 years, Vickie. They have two grown sons, Kyle and Korey. All four of them were born on the land that now holds the Kendallville Public Library...back when it held the McCray Hospital.
Reagan came to the library after having been an accountant, then a teacher. He holds Bachelor’s degrees in physics, math and physical education and also a Masters in business administration. He uses many of those skills as he tutors students at the library and The Wreck.
“I love working with teens,” said Reagan. “It keeps me young...at heart, anyways.”
That’s evident through his volunteerism at The Wreck. He’s been with the teen center since it began nine years ago.
In addition to working with the teens, he keeps all the computers running there, too.
Despite the amount of time he spends here, he says he enjoys coming to work surrounded by the beauty of the lake.
The staff appreciates his good nature when we’ve got a computer problem we can’t seem to fix on our own, and are lucky to have such a dedicated Information Technology Manager.
